WebStay calm. Although most bees usually only sting once, wasps and hornets can sting again. If you are stung, calmly walk away from the area to avoid additional attacks. Remove the stinger. If the stinger remains in your skin, remove it by scraping over it with your fingernail or a piece of gauze. byju\u0027s learning kitWebMar 28, 2024 · Well, bees could be of good luck and they can bad luck.
